How does Al-Hedim Square reflect the culture of Meknes?

Cultural Reflection

Al-Hedim Square stands as a cultural beacon in Meknes, embodying the essence of the city's heritage and traditions. It reflects the culture of Meknes in various ways:

1. Artisanal Crafts

The presence of local artisans and craft vendors around the square showcases the city's rich tradition of craftsmanship and artistic skills.

2. Traditional Music and Dance

Visitors can enjoy performances by local musicians and dancers, immersing themselves in the melodic tunes and rhythmic beats of traditional Moroccan music.

3. Architectural Heritage

The architectural marvels within the square, from intricate tile work to grand arches, pay homage to the historical and artistic legacy of Meknes.

4. Community Gatherings

Al-Hedim Square serves as a gathering place for locals and tourists to come together, fostering a sense of community and cultural exchange in the heart of the city.
